| Offshore Assets
Decommisioning, Retrofitting, Abandoning or Extending Life: thinking of alternative uses? Using new technology to recover hitherto uneconomic reserves: Then read on.......
Original corrosion protection involved the use of sacrificial anodes designed to suit the originally planned life of the structure. Impalloy supplied many of these anodes, which may be approaching the end of their planned life and must be replaced. Recognizing the costs, logisitics and health & safety issues involved, Impalloy has been developing a series of retrofit options that can in some cases completely remove the need for either production shut downs, or dive time. Anode separation is designed to maximise the protective effect of the anodes, so reducing weights required.
The products available cover the full range of applications, from rigs, jackets, protection structures, well heads and pipelines.
Impalloys focus in this area is to maximise anodes delivered per deployment, while keeping the delivery systems within UK road transport parameters, avoiding costly transport costs.

C-Gard SD Supasled
|
The Impalloy C-Guard retrofit anode sled range includes a large output capacity Single Deployment Supasled (SDS), providing a considerable mass of anodes in one operation. The C-Gard™ SDSupasled is ideal for large structures and can be easily installed on the seabed. Dive time is reduced due to ease of installation and may be limited to simply cleaning the attachment point, fitting and tightening the clamp. |

C-Gard SD supasled

|
The C-Gard SD Supasled ICCP enable retrofitting of impressed current anodes in a simple and quick manner. The SD Supasleds can be positioned some distance away from the asset to be protected. Multicore cables are laid across the seabed in the installation operation and terminated in waterproof connectors. A number of sleds can then be connected to a header cable through a J tube. Impalloy can supply TRs in a variety of formats to suit client specifications. |

C-Gard Midisled
|
The C-Gard Midisled is a mid range unit that is designed to have a low profile with sloped sides and protection screens, which means that the unit is less likley to be damaged or moved by trawler boards It is therefore ideal for pipeline retrofit, by way of cable connectors to exisiting anode brackets.
They can be fitted with a variety of anode sizes, cable diameters and clamp assemblies. The sled base can be fabricated to clients sizes to suit, with fixing systems adapted for the structure. .

| C-Gard Hexapod and Octopod
|
For smaller structures Hexapods can be used, with a range of anode current outputs and weights. These can be lowered to the sea bed and connected by cables to the structure. The anode legs can be extended to raise the anodes away from the sea bed allowing for siltation.
These units can be made to suit specific customer requirements, in terms of size and anode capacity, Some designs can be stacked on top of each other on vessel decks therefore saving space and reducing costs.
Octopods can carry large mass of anodes, and are designed to fit into standard shipping containers. Final assembing on dock side or vessel decks allows for a maximum space /weight utilisation.

C-Gard Non-Weld Anodes  |
These are designed to be fitted to existing tubular structures to replace expired anodes. They can also be cabled to other structures and insulated from the mounting structure with neoprene. They do not require underwater welding and so can be installed by non coded dive teams.
They can be manufactured in all the standard sizes and insert configurations. The clamp is available in sizes to suit the existing structure.
The surface is prepared by removing gross marine fouling organisms and any other deposits The installation involves either lowering via crane or floating with airbags, offering the clamp onto the structure component and bolting up. Electrical continuity is made by tightening the cone head bolts and cutting through the paint film.

Segmented Bracelet Anode
|
Pipelines or piles can be retrofitted with anode bracelets based on designs similar to the illustration. The band can be welded together or bolt fixed as a preference.
